您好,欢迎访问上海聚搜信息技术有限公司官方网站!
24小时咨询热线:4008-020-360

阿里云国际站注册教程:安卓开发连接ftp服务器

时间:2025-04-15 01:21:04 点击:

阿里云国际站注册教程:安卓开发连接FTP服务器

在进行安卓开发时,经常需要将项目文件上传到服务器或者下载更新的文件。而FTP(文件传输协议)作为一种常见的文件传输方式,常被用来实现这一需求。阿里云提供了强大的云服务,可以让开发者轻松搭建并连接FTP服务器,进行文件管理和传输。本文将介绍如何在阿里云国际站上注册并配置FTP服务器,适用于安卓开发者的需求。

阿里云国际站的优势

阿里云是全球领先的云计算和人工智能科技公司,提供了全面的云服务和解决方案。其国际站为全球用户提供高质量的云服务,尤其在数据传输、存储和处理能力上有显著优势。以下是阿里云的几个主要优势:

  • 全球覆盖:阿里云国际站的服务器遍布全球多个数据中心,支持全球范围内的低延迟和高速度服务,适合各种地区的开发者使用。
  • 高安全性:阿里云提供多层次的安全防护,包括防火墙、DDoS防护等,确保开发者的数据传输过程安全无忧。
  • 稳定可靠:阿里云的云服务器具有高可用性,支持自动备份和容灾处理,确保服务器稳定运行,减少业务中断的风险。
  • 灵活扩展:根据业务需求,阿里云可以随时扩展服务器资源,支持快速弹性扩展,适应不同规模的开发需求。
  • 丰富的开发工具:阿里云提供了完善的开发工具和SDK,支持安卓开发者高效地接入云服务,进行快速部署和操作。

阿里云国际站注册流程

在阿里云国际站注册并搭建FTP服务器的第一步是注册阿里云账号。以下是注册流程:

  1. 访问阿里云官网:打开浏览器,访问阿里云国际站的官网:https://www.alibabacloud.com
  2. 创建账户:点击“注册”按钮,填写你的个人信息,包括邮箱地址、用户名和密码等。系统会发送激活邮件到你的邮箱,点击链接激活账户。
  3. 选择服务区域:注册完成后,选择你所在的区域,阿里云提供全球不同地区的服务节点,可以根据你的实际需求选择一个合适的区域。
  4. 完成实名认证:根据阿里云的要求,完成实名认证。这一过程需要提供身份证或护照等身份证明材料。
  5. 支付账户充值:在完成实名认证后,往阿里云账户中充值一定金额,用于购买后续的云服务。

搭建FTP服务器

注册并登录阿里云账户后,接下来是搭建FTP服务器,供安卓开发者进行文件传输。以下是详细步骤:

  1. 购买云服务器ECS:在阿里云国际站首页,选择“产品与服务”,点击“云服务器 ECS”。选择适合你的操作系统(例如Ubuntu或CentOS)和配置,购买并创建云服务器。
  2. 连接到云服务器:购买成功后,可以通过SSH连接到云服务器。你可以使用终端命令(Linux)或Putty(Windows)工具连接到云服务器。
  3. 安装FTP服务器软件:连接成功后,可以使用命令行安装FTP服务器软件,例如vsftpd(非常安全的FTP守护程序)。安装命令如下:
  4. sudo apt update
        sudo apt install vsftpd
  5. 配置FTP服务器:安装完成后,编辑配置文件,允许匿名访问或者指定特定用户进行文件上传和下载。
  6. sudo nano /etc/vsftpd.conf

    在配置文件中,设置以下内容以确保FTP服务器的正常运行:

    • anonymous_enable=YES (允许匿名用户访问)
    • local_enable=YES (允许本地用户访问)
    • write_enable=YES (允许写入权限)
  7. 重启FTP服务:配置完成后,重启FTP服务以使配置生效:
  8. sudo systemctl restart vsftpd
  9. 开放FTP端口:为了让安卓设备能够访问FTP服务器,需要在阿里云控制台中为云服务器开放21号端口(FTP的默认端口)。在阿里云控制台中,找到“安全组”设置,编辑入站规则,添加TCP端口21。

在安卓设备上连接FTP服务器

搭建完FTP服务器后,可以通过安卓设备访问和管理FTP服务器上的文件。以下是安卓设备连接FTP服务器的步骤:

  1. 下载FTP客户端:在Google Play商店中搜索并下载一个FTP客户端,例如ES文件浏览器或FTP客户端。
  2. 配置FTP服务器连接:打开FTP客户端,输入FTP服务器的IP地址、端口号(默认为21)以及用户名和密码(如果有的话)。
  3. 连接并管理文件:配置完成后,点击“连接”按钮,安卓设备即可与阿里云上的FTP服务器连接成功。你可以上传或下载文件,进行文件管理。

总结

阿里云国际站为全球开发者提供了强大的云计算服务,支持高效、安全、稳定的FTP文件传输功能。通过简单的注册流程和几步配置,开发者可以快速搭建自己的FTP服务器,进行文件管理和传输。阿里云不仅在性能和安全性上具有优势,还提供了灵活的扩展能力,非常适合安卓开发者使用。希望本文的教程能够帮助大家顺利搭建并使用阿里云FTP服务器,提升开发效率。

收缩
  • 电话咨询

  • 4008-020-360
微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线: 15026612550